Output 2e5f7cf901b670c9412778d259e84d436005cb36be55f7536ad2e4a0822af9d4:4

value
407860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a1d0f531a11c15502bcb4d0c77cfce092504bb5 OP_EQUAL
address
3QVVfcgKTRC3gSz2T2SpBDpicL4PwBf6be
transaction
2e5f7cf901b670c9412778d259e84d436005cb36be55f7536ad2e4a0822af9d4
confirmations
353519
spent
true